With 160 keys, Atmosphere Core joins the Shirdi market.

Atmosphere Core and Assotech Realty have partnered to develop an all-suite, high-end hotel property in Shirdi. Ideally situated within thirty minutes from Shirdi International Airport, SANDAL SUITES by Atmosphere Shirdi is scheduled to open in the second quarter of 2028.

The all-suite upper luxury hotel, which will operate under the “by Atmosphere” sub-brand of Atmosphere Hotels & Resorts, will have 160 suites, each measuring 45 square meters and meticulously built to capture views of the serene landscapes and verdant surrounds of western India.
The facility offers a variety of carefully chosen indoor and outdoor activities, including a spa and wellness center run by Atmosphere Core’s renowned wellness brand ELE|NA Ayur, which will provide a tranquil haven with a view of the pilgrimage corridor. The resort will have boardrooms, banquets, large lawns, outdoor event spaces, and contemporary indoor conference areas.
